STL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2018 in Review
300 of the 4,364 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Sterling Bancorp (STL) for Q1 2018, worth a combined $4.67B — down 4.6% from $4.9B a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 41 funds opened new STL positions and 40 closed out — a net gain of 1 holder — while 120 added to existing stakes and 93 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Lazard Asset Management, adding an estimated $49.2M. The largest seller was Dimensional Fund Advisors, cutting an estimated $45.7M.
